11:10 NLT
逐节对照
  • New Living Translation - You will be slaughtered all the way to the borders of Israel. I will execute judgment on you, and you will know that I am the Lord.
  • 新标点和合本 - 你们必倒在刀下;我必在以色列的境界审判你们,你们就知道我是耶和华。
  • 和合本2010(上帝版-简体) - 你们要仆倒在刀下;我必在以色列的边界审判你们,你们就知道我是耶和华。
  • 和合本2010(神版-简体) - 你们要仆倒在刀下;我必在以色列的边界审判你们,你们就知道我是耶和华。
  • 当代译本 - 使你们死于刀下。我要审判整个以色列,这样你们就知道我是耶和华。
  • 圣经新译本 - 你们必倒在刀下,我必审判你们,直到以色列的边境;你们就知道我是耶和华。
  • 现代标点和合本 - 你们必倒在刀下,我必在以色列的境界审判你们,你们就知道我是耶和华。
  • 和合本(拼音版) - 你们必倒在刀下,我必在以色列的境界审判你们,你们就知道我是耶和华。
  • New International Version - You will fall by the sword, and I will execute judgment on you at the borders of Israel. Then you will know that I am the Lord.
  • New International Reader's Version - You will be killed by swords. I will judge you at the borders of Israel. Then you will know that I am the Lord.
  • English Standard Version - You shall fall by the sword. I will judge you at the border of Israel, and you shall know that I am the Lord.
  • Christian Standard Bible - You will fall by the sword, and I will judge you at the border of Israel. Then you will know that I am the Lord.
  • New American Standard Bible - You will fall by the sword. I will judge you to the border of Israel; so you shall know that I am the Lord.
  • New King James Version - You shall fall by the sword. I will judge you at the border of Israel. Then you shall know that I am the Lord.
  • Amplified Bible - You will fall by the sword; I will judge and punish you [in front of your neighbors] at the border of [the land of] Israel; and you will know [without any doubt] that I am the Lord.
  • American Standard Version - Ye shall fall by the sword; I will judge you in the border of Israel; and ye shall know that I am Jehovah.
  • King James Version - Ye shall fall by the sword; I will judge you in the border of Israel; and ye shall know that I am the Lord.
  • New English Translation - You will die by the sword; I will judge you at the border of Israel. Then you will know that I am the Lord.
  • World English Bible - You will fall by the sword. I will judge you in the border of Israel. Then you will know that I am Yahweh.
  • 新標點和合本 - 你們必倒在刀下;我必在以色列的境界審判你們,你們就知道我是耶和華。
  • 和合本2010(上帝版-繁體) - 你們要仆倒在刀下;我必在以色列的邊界審判你們,你們就知道我是耶和華。
  • 和合本2010(神版-繁體) - 你們要仆倒在刀下;我必在以色列的邊界審判你們,你們就知道我是耶和華。
  • 當代譯本 - 使你們死於刀下。我要審判整個以色列,這樣你們就知道我是耶和華。
  • 聖經新譯本 - 你們必倒在刀下,我必審判你們,直到以色列的邊境;你們就知道我是耶和華。
  • 呂振中譯本 - 你們必倒斃於刀下;我必在 以色列 境界判罰你們,你們就知道我乃是永恆主。
  • 現代標點和合本 - 你們必倒在刀下,我必在以色列的境界審判你們,你們就知道我是耶和華。
  • 文理和合譯本 - 爾必隕於鋒刃、我必鞫爾於以色列之邊界、則知我乃耶和華、
  • 文理委辦譯本 - 以色列族接壤之地、必罹禍患、亡於鋒刃、使知我乃耶和華。
  • 施約瑟淺文理新舊約聖經 - 爾曹必殞於鋒刃、我必在 以色列 地之邊界罰爾、爾則知我乃主、
  • Nueva Versión Internacional - Morirán a filo de espada; yo los juzgaré en las mismas fronteras de Israel, y así sabrán que yo soy el Señor.
  • 현대인의 성경 - 너희가 칼날에 쓰러질 것이다. 내가 이스라엘 국경에서 너희를 심판하겠다. 너희가 그제야 나를 여호와인 줄 알 것이다.
  • Новый Русский Перевод - Вы падете от меча; Я буду судить вас на границе Израиля. Тогда вы узнаете, что Я – Господь.
  • Восточный перевод - Вы падёте от меча; Я буду судить вас на границе Исраила . Тогда вы узнаете, что Я – Вечный.
  • Восточный перевод, версия с «Аллахом» - Вы падёте от меча; Я буду судить вас на границе Исраила . Тогда вы узнаете, что Я – Вечный.
  • Восточный перевод, версия для Таджикистана - Вы падёте от меча; Я буду судить вас на границе Исроила . Тогда вы узнаете, что Я – Вечный.
  • La Bible du Semeur 2015 - Vous tomberez victimes de l’épée. C’est sur le territoire du pays d’Israël que je vous jugerai, et vous reconnaîtrez que je suis l’Eternel.
  • リビングバイブル - あなたがたは、イスラエルの国境に至るすべての道で殺される。その時、わたしが主であることを知る。
  • Nova Versão Internacional - Vocês cairão à espada, e eu os julgarei nas fronteiras de Israel. Então vocês saberão que eu sou o Senhor.
  • Hoffnung für alle - und lasse euch durch das Schwert umkommen. Bis hin zur Grenze Israels werde ich mein Urteil an euch vollstrecken; daran sollt ihr erkennen, dass ich der Herr bin.
  • Kinh Thánh Hiện Đại - Các ngươi sẽ bị tàn sát tại mỗi đường biên giới của Ít-ra-ên. Ta sẽ thi hành công lý trên các ngươi, và các ngươi sẽ biết Ta là Chúa Hằng Hữu.
  • พระคริสตธรรมคัมภีร์ไทย ฉบับอมตธรรมร่วมสมัย - เจ้าจะล้มตายด้วยดาบและเราจะพิพากษาเจ้าที่ชายแดนอิสราเอล เมื่อนั้นเจ้าจะรู้ว่าเราคือพระยาห์เวห์
  • พระคัมภีร์ ฉบับแปลใหม่ - พวก​เจ้า​จะ​ตาย​ด้วย​คม​ดาบ เรา​จะ​ลง​โทษ​เจ้า​ที่​ชาย​แดน​อิสราเอล แล้ว​พวก​เจ้า​จะ​รู้​ว่า เรา​คือ​พระ​ผู้​เป็น​เจ้า
